#principal { background-image:url(imagenes/fondo2.gif);
		background-repeat:repeat;
		/*behavior: url(iepngfix.htc);*/
		/*position: relative;*/ }

a:link { text-decoration:none;
		font-weight: bold;
		color:#000000; }
a:visited { text-decoration:none;
		font-weight: bold;
		color:#000000; }
a:active { text-decoration:none;
		font-weight: bold;
		color:#000000; }
a:hover { text-decoration:none;
		font-weight: bold;
		color:#000000; }

td p a:hover{
	text-decoration:underline;
	font-weight:bold;
	color:#000000;
}


body { 	margin-top:1.00em; 
		margin-left:2.00em; 
		background-attachment:fixed; 
		background-image:url(imagenes/fondo.gif);
		font-family:Arial, Helvetica, sans-serif;
} 

div dl {
	margin-top:0.30em;
	margin-left:0.30em;

}

dt {
	padding-top: 0.30em;
	padding-left:1.25em;
}

dd {
	text-align:justify;
	padding-right:2.50em;
	padding-top:0.15em;
	padding-bottom:0.15em;
}

table td a img {	height:0.5em; 
					width:0.5em; 
					border-color:#000000; 
					border-width:1px;
				}

.imprimir {
	height:1.38em;
	width:1.38em;
	padding-left:0.24em;
	margin:0em;
	border:none;
}

#calendario {
	border:none;
	height:1.0em;
	width:1.0em;
}